Distinction

Cineverse is not just a single consumer streaming app; it is a broader media company with owned streaming brands, ad monetisation products and B2B streaming infrastructure. It is also distinct from generalist streamers such as Netflix or Tubi because it focuses on niche fandom verticals and commercialises underlying media technology.

Cineverse: About

Cineverse combines a publisher-and-platform model with software monetisation. It owns and operates niche streaming destinations that attract fan audiences, monetises those audiences through advertising and subscriptions, and then commercialises the underlying infrastructure through B2B products. This creates value by linking owned content inventory, audience data, distribution workflows and monetisation tooling into a single operating stack serving both consumers and enterprise media customers.

Cineverse: Market Position

Cineverse is a US-listed entertainment company that operates a portfolio of niche video streaming services and related advertising and distribution technology. Its consumer portfolio includes genre-led streaming brands such as Fandor, Screambox, RetroCrush, AsianCrush, Docurama, Dove Channel and Midnight Pulp, while its business-facing products include Cineverse 360 for advertising, Matchpoint for streaming supply-chain management, and cineSearch for Business for search and discovery.

The company makes money through a hybrid model spanning ad-supported streaming, subscription video services, content licensing and distribution, and B2B licensing of streaming and monetisation technology. Its direct paying customers therefore include advertisers, media agencies, content owners, studios, streaming platforms, OEMs and digital distributors, alongside consumers subscribing to selected niche services.

Cineverse: Frequently Asked Questions

What is Cineverse?

Cineverse is a public entertainment company that operates niche streaming services and sells advertising and streaming technology to media and brand customers.

Who uses Cineverse?

Its users include consumers watching genre-led streaming services, as well as advertisers, agencies, content owners, studios, OEMs and streaming platforms buying its B2B products.

How does Cineverse make money?

It earns revenue from advertising on ad-supported streaming inventory, subscription fees, content licensing and B2B licensing of products such as Matchpoint, cineSearch for Business and related monetisation tools.
